Common Cinder Block Wall Repair Jobs
Cracked or damaged cinder block walls - repairs to restore structural integrity and appearance.
Leaning or bowing walls - stabilization services to prevent further movement.
Efflorescence or surface staining - cleaning and sealing to improve wall aesthetics.
Hollow or deteriorated blocks - replacement of compromised blocks for durability.
Mortar joint deterioration - repointing to strengthen wall connections.
Foundation or basement wall issues - repairs to address water infiltration and stability concerns.
Cinder Block Wall Repair Questions
What causes cinder block walls to need repair? Common causes include settling, water damage, and cracking due to temperature changes or impacts.
How can I tell if my cinder block wall needs repair? Signs include visible cracks, bulging, leaning, or deteriorated mortar joints.
What types of repairs are common for cinder block walls? Repairs often involve patching cracks, replacing damaged blocks, and reinforcing weak areas.
Is it possible to prevent damage to cinder block walls? Proper drainage, sealing cracks early, and regular inspections help maintain wall integrity.
